  • Lot #414 - 1879-S NGC MS-64
  • Gold $5-Liberty Head Half Eagle
  • 7 graded MS-64, which ties for highest graded at NGC. PCGS suggests five coins grade higher in their population report. Technically, 1879-S is not a scarce date but obviously, the set collector will be hard-pressed to locate a stronger candidate for a registry. Overall light hairlining limits the grade.

  • Lot #96 - Spain - 1774/3-M PJ 1/2 escudo - NGC AU-55
  • Hammer: $500
  • World Coins-Spain
  • Lemonade Stand Collection. KM#415.2, Madrid mint. Almost never found truly problem-free, it's quite a feat to locate such a well-preserved 1/2-escudo that hasn't become infested with hairlines or surface damage. Light friction wears on the surface, of course, but the gleaming yellow-gold hue pleases the eye.
